Why Orthodontic Wax For Braces Is Necessary
When I first got braces, I quickly realized that orthodontic wax was not just a small extra—it was something I truly needed. The brackets and wires can rub against the inside of my cheeks, lips, and gums, especially in the beginning. Putting wax over the sharp or irritating parts helped me feel more comfortable and made it easier to eat, talk, and get through the day without constant soreness.
I also found that orthodontic wax helped protect my mouth while it was adjusting to the braces. Even a tiny wire or bracket can cause painful spots or small cuts if I leave it uncovered. Using wax gave me a simple barrier that reduced friction and prevented irritation, which made my braces experience much more manageable.
Another reason I consider orthodontic wax necessary is that it gives me quick relief anytime I need it. It is easy to use, portable, and helps me handle discomfort until I can see my orthodontist if something feels wrong. For me, it has been one of the easiest and most effective ways to stay comfortable during orthodontic treatment.
My Buying Guides on Orthodontic Wax For Braces
What I Look for in Orthodontic Wax
When I shop for orthodontic wax for braces, I first check whether it is safe, easy to use, and comfortable on my mouth. I want a wax that creates a smooth barrier between my braces and the inside of my lips or cheeks. I also look for a product that stays in place for several hours without breaking apart too quickly.
Material and Safety
I always make sure the wax is made from oral-safe ingredients. Since it goes directly in my mouth, I prefer wax that is non-toxic and free from harsh additives. If I have any sensitivity, I choose a product that is odorless and flavorless so it does not irritate me.
Ease of Application
For me, the best orthodontic wax is simple to apply. I like wax that softens easily between my fingers and sticks well to the braces. If it is too hard or crumbly, I find it frustrating to use. A good wax should help me quickly cover sharp brackets or wires without much effort.
Durability and Comfort
I pay attention to how long the wax lasts once I apply it. I prefer something that can hold up through talking, eating soft foods, and daily activities. At the same time, it should feel comfortable and not create extra bulk in my mouth. The right wax helps reduce irritation and makes wearing braces much easier.
Pack Size and Value
I also consider how much wax comes in the package. If I need it often, I look for a larger supply so I do not run out too quickly. I compare price with quantity to make sure I am getting good value. For me, it is worth paying a little more if the wax performs better and lasts longer.
Texture and Transparency
I usually prefer wax with a smooth texture because it is easier to mold over braces. Some waxes are clear or translucent, which I like because they are less noticeable. A softer texture can feel more natural in my mouth, while a firmer one may stay in place better depending on my needs.
Portability
Since I may need wax while I am away from home, I like a package that is small and easy to carry. Individual strips or compact containers are convenient for me to keep in a bag, pocket, or school kit. Portability matters because braces discomfort can happen anytime.
